Get-SalesPrice #
ÜBERSICHT #
Ermittelt den Verkaufspreis eines Artikels für eine bestimmte Adresse.
SYNTAX #
Get-SalesPrice [-Conn] <__ComObject> [-ArticleId] <int> [-AddressId] <int> [[-Quantity] <decimal>]
[[-Currency] <string>] [-IncludeVat] [[-CurrencyAlternative] <string>] [[-CurrencyRate]
<decimal>] [<CommonParameters>]
BESCHREIBUNG #
Diese Funktion ermittelt den Verkaufspreis eines Artikels aus der Datenbank, inklusive Rabatt, Preis- und Verpackungseinheit. Dabei kann optional eine Menge, Währung und alternative Währung mit Kurs angegeben werden. Der zurückgelieferte Verkaufspreis (= Vk) Entspricht dem, der bei einer manuellen Auftragsanlage ermittelt werden würde.
PARAMETER #
-Conn #
Type: __ComObject
Eine aktive COM-Verbindung (ADO Connection-Objekt) zur EULANDA-Datenbank.
-ArticleId #
Type: int
Die Artikel-ID aus der Tabelle ARTIKEL.
-AddressId #
Type: int
Die Adress-ID aus der Tabelle ADRESSE.
-Quantity #
Type: decimal
Default: 1.0
Die Menge, für die der Preis berechnet werden soll (Standard ist 1.0). Dieser Wert ist wichtig, wenn es zu dem verwendeten Artikel mengenbezogene Preislisen (= Staffelpreise) gibt.
-Currency #
Type: string
Default: 'EUR'
Die Zielwährung des Preises (Standard ist ‘EUR’).
-IncludeVat #
Type: switch
Wenn gesetzt, wird der Vk inklusive MwSt. zurückgeliefert.
-CurrencyAlternative #
Type: string
Default: $null
Alternativwährung für die interne Umrechnung (Standard: Zielwährung).
-CurrencyRate #
Type: decimal
Default: 1.0
Umrechnungskurs für die Alternativwährung (Standard ist 1.0).
BEISPIELE #
$result = Get-SalesPrice -Conn $conn -AddressId 956 -ArticleId 1141 -Quantity 10
$result | Format-List